TYPES OF ENERGY

Energy is the ability or capacity to do work. Every activity that occurs around us requires energy. There are many forms or types of energy, and each one is useful in different ways. These types of energy can change from one form to another, but the total energy remains constant.

Below are the major types of energy taught in Basic Science for Junior Secondary School in Nigeria:

  1. Mechanical Energy

  2. Mechanical energy is the energy a body possesses due to its motion or position. It has two parts:

    a) Kinetic Energy

    This is the energy a body has because it is moving.

    Examples:

    1. A running boy

    2. A moving car

    3. A flowing river

    b) Potential Energy

    This is stored energy that a body has because of its position or shape.

    Examples:

    1. Water stored in a tank

    2. A book placed on a shelf

    3. A stretched rubber band

    Mechanical energy = Potential Energy + Kinetic Energy.

  3. Chemical Energy

  4. Chemical energy is the energy stored inside substances. This energy is released during chemical reactions.

    Examples:

    1. Food contains chemical energy that the body uses

    2. Petrol and diesel release chemical energy when burnt

    3. Batteries store chemical energy and release it when used

  5. Heat Energy (Thermal Energy)

  6. Heat energy is the energy that causes objects to become warm or hot.

    Heat energy can be produced through:

    1. Burning

    2. Friction (rubbing two things together)

    3. Electricity

    Examples:

    1. The heat from the sun

    2. The heat from a cooker

    3. Ironing clothes

  7. Light Energy

  8. Light energy is the energy that enables us to see.

    Sources of light include:

    1. The sun (the major natural source)

    2. Electric bulbs

    3. Candles

    4. Fire

    Plants use light energy from the sun to make food through photosynthesis.

  9. Sound Energy

  10. Sound energy is produced when objects vibrate.

    Examples:

    1. Sound from radios

    2. Talking or singing

    3. Beating a drum

    Sound helps us to communicate and to hear what is happening around us.

  11. Electrical Energy

  12. Electrical energy is the energy caused by the movement of electric charges. It is very useful because it can easily be changed into other forms, such as light, heat, and sound.

    Examples:

    1. Electricity in homes and schools

    2. Electric fans

    3. Freezers and refrigerators

    4. Televisions

  13. Solar Energy

  14. Solar energy is energy from the sun. It is a natural and renewable form of energy.

    Examples:

    1. Solar panels

    2. Drying clothes in the sun

    3. Solar water heaters

  15. Nuclear Energy

  16. Nuclear energy is the energy released from the nucleus of atoms. It comes from nuclear reactions like fission and fusion. Although not common in Nigeria, it is used in some countries to generate electricity.

  17. Elastic Energy

  18. Elastic energy is the energy stored in objects that can stretch or compress.

    Examples:

    1. A stretched spring

    2. A stretched rubber band

    3. A bow before shooting an arrow

  19. Magnetic Energy

  20. Magnetic energy is the energy stored in magnets and magnetic fields.

    Examples:

    1. Magnets used to pick up metal objects

    2. Magnetic strips on ATM cards

    3. Door magnets in refrigerators


Renewable and Non-renewable Energy
  1. Renewable Energy

  2. Renewable energy comes from natural sources that can be replaced or replenished within a short period of time. These sources do not run out easily because nature constantly renews them.

    Examples:

    1. Solar energy (from the sun)

    2. Wind energy

    3. Water or hydro energy

    4. Biomass (from plants and animals)

    5. Geothermal energy (heat from beneath the earth)

    Key Features:

    1. Clean and environmentally friendly

    2. Will not get exhausted

    3. Can be used repeatedly

  3. Non-renewable Energy

  4. Non-renewable energy comes from sources that cannot be replaced quickly. Once they are used up, they take millions of years to form again. These resources are limited and can eventually run out.

    Examples:

    1. Crude oil (petroleum)

    2. Coal

    3. Natural gas

    4. Nuclear fuel (uranium)

    Key Features:

    1. They cause pollution when used

    2. They are limited in supply

    3. They may become very expensive when scarce




Summary

Energy is the ability to do work and exists in many forms such as mechanical, chemical, heat, light, sound, and electrical energy.

Each type of energy has a unique source and use, but they can all change from one form to another.

The total amount of energy remains constant because energy cannot be created or destroyed.
